Overview

This scholarship/bursary supports entering university students graduating from a Canadian high school. Each award is valued at $16,000 over four years and is intended for students with strong academic standing, financial need, leadership qualities, and initiative in funding their education.

Eligibility

Who is eligible?

  • Entering university students
  • Students graduating from Canadian high schools

Eligible geographic areas

  • Canada

Processing and Agreement

  • Applications are reviewed after submission for the relevant academic year.
  • The number of awards may vary from year to year.
  • Applicants should check the scholarship page for the next application cycle.

Additional information

  • The award is renewed each year if renewal criteria are met.
  • Schools may recommend multiple students.
  • All students who meet the selection criteria are encouraged to apply.
